General Information about #280904
The hexadecimal color code #280904 represents a very dark shade of red. It is often described as a deep burgundy or maroon color. In the RGB color model, #280904 is composed of 15.69% red, 3.53% green, and 1.57% blue. In the CMYK color model, if offers 0% cyan, 77.5% magenta, 90% yellow, and 84.3% black. The color #280904, a deep, muted burgundy, presents significant accessibility challenges. Its low luminance value necessitates careful consideration of contrast ratios, especially for text. According to WCAG guidelines, sufficient contrast between text and background is crucial for readability, particularly for users with visual impairments. For normal text (size 14 or 18 pt), a contrast ratio of 4.5:1 is recommended, while for large text (size 18 pt bold or 24 pt), the requirement is 3:1. Given the darkness of #280904, pairing it with very light colors like white or pale yellow is essential to meet these standards. Using this color as a background for large blocks of text is inadvisable without thorough contrast analysis. Furthermore, avoid using it for small interactive elements or icons, where visual clarity is paramount. When in doubt, tools like WebAIM's Contrast Checker can provide accurate assessments and guidance.
